    Hi all,

    I am new to Reaktor and have a few questions, if you have the patience:

    1) How do I load a sample and loop it? The only way I could manage to do was to create an instrument, place a sampler into it and trigger the sample via the keyboard. I wonder if I can play the sample without a Midi-in (notepitch for ex.) input.

    2) I have plugged my guitar from the line-in into the Reaktor. The sound I hear through my speakers has a certain latency. How can I avoid that latency? There is also certain amount of hissing sound.

    Welcome to the forum :)

    1) see picture for an example of a Button triggering the sample at Pitch 60 (the pitch it was sampled at). note Loop is On in the Sample Map Editor.

    2) Latency has to do with your Computer and the Sound Card that you use, and also the settings in your Reaktor Audio MIDI Settings. you can reduce the latency at the cost of using more CPU. are you using a Mac or PC? there will always be hiss from a guitar, but again, this depends on your Soundcard and the quality of the Audio to Digital converters.
